Mike- it's just the opposite.  As water from the pump goes through the eductor, it pulls in surrounding water with it, thereby increasing the net movement of water.  The ones for aquarium use are just a specialized output fitting to put on the end of a return line.

I have used them in the past and they do work but.... He was right you need a good sized pump to really see a differance. I dont think it would hard to make them.

 

The principal that causes an eductor to work is pretty simple. The fast moving water is lower in pressure than the surrounding water causing the surrounding water to get pulled along with the faster moving water. This is occuring around the entire eductor so the total volume is increased many times.
